Composite Door Hinges Adjustment

A hinge that is not aligned properly can cause your door to be caught at the bottom or fail to close properly. Regular maintenance and lubrication can solve these problems.

Adjusting composite door hinges can be accomplished quickly and easily! This guide will show you how to fix your door to ensure it performs as new.

Hinges

Hinges are essential to the smooth operation of a composite door. They are also responsible for ensuring that it shuts properly, preventing draughts and ensuring a safe entryway for your home. If you find that your door isn't closing smoothly, or that it is sticking at the corners or sliding along the bottom, this may be a sign that your hinges need adjusting. The good thing is that this is an easy process that can be done easily with the right tools.

You must identify the hinge type on your composite door. There are two kinds of hinges: standard and ball bearing. Both hinges can be adjusted in similarly, but for the sake of simplicity, we will focus on the adjustment of the standard hinge.

Start by loosening the screws that secure the hinge to the frame and jamb by using the screwdriver. When the hinge is freed from the rest of the door it is possible to loosen the three adjustment screws; one on each side of the hinge. After the hinges are loosened, you can then tighten the screws to secure the hinges in their new position.

After you have adjusted the hinges of your composite door, you must test it to make sure that it closes properly and smoothly. It's also recommended to perform regular maintenance, such as lubricating the pivot points of the hinge to prevent damage and enhance the performance.

Loosening the Screws

A hinge for a composite door that is not in alignment can lead to a variety of issues, from making it difficult to open the door to the hinges catching on the frame, creating gaps for drafts. A little maintenance can make a huge difference in preventing this from happening and is an important aspect of keeping your home secure and safe.

To adjust the hinges on your composite door remove the screws that hold them in place. This will make it easier to adjust. This procedure can differ based on the type and placement of hinges, so consult the manual that came along with your door to find more details.

The next step is to remove any plastic caps that may be covering the screws for adjustment on the hinges. This can be done by simply removing them using a screwdriver. This step will save you from accidentally stripping or otherwise damaging the screw heads or the attachment points for the hinges locks.

Then, you'll need to loosen the screw for compression adjustment on the hinge plate. You can loosen it clockwise or counter-clockwise. This will increase the compression which allows the hinge to sit snugly against the door's frame.

T hinges can be adjusted vertically and laterally and are very similar to flag hinges. However, they don't often have a compression adjustment therefore, you'll have to follow the steps outlined above for flag hinges to adjust them.

It's important to test the door after having adjusted the composite hinges. This will ensure that the door closes and opens smoothly, without any creaking. Verify that the latch is in contact with the keeper. In addition, it's recommended to conduct regular maintenance and adjustments, such as lubrication, to prolong the life of your door.
